[0039] Taking the 1450mm tandem cold rolling mill as an example, the strip tracking control system adopts Siemens TDC real-time multitasking processor, and additional weld detectors are installed in the pickling handover area, the entrance of the rolling mill, the exit of the pickling looper and the entrance of the rolling mill. One location counter is set per tracking area. The maximum entry speed of the strip mill is 6 m / s, and the maximum exit speed of the rolling mill is 20 m / s.

[0040] The strip tracking area of ​​the cold tandem mill is divided into pickling transfer area, mill entrance area 1-2 rack area, 2-3 rack area, 3-4 rack area, 4-5 rack area, 5 rack-flying area Shearing area, No. 1 coiling area, and No. 2 coiling area. The specific tracking area location settings are shown in Table 1.

Abstract

Disclosed is a tracking processing method for band steel on a cold tandem mill. The tracking processing method comprises the following steps of division of a band steel tracking area, weld joint tracking, a request for a set value, wedge-shaped rolling control and calculation of a shearing position. 9 divided band steel tracking regions are subjected to position setting. After a weld joint enters the tracking area, the operation distance of the weld joint is calculated. Speed selection of the tracking regions and position correction of the weld joint are conducted, and an effective judgment is made to a detection signal of the weld joint. The set value is requested and confirmed before weld joint enters the mill. Wedge-shaped rolling control is conducted. When the length of wedge-shaped rolling reaches a set length, a rolling set value is transitioned to the new set value of the band steel, and then the shearing position is determined according to the conditions of the widths of the parts, in front of the weld joint or behind the weld joint, of the band steel. According to the tracking processing method, the actual position of the band steel on a production line of the cold tandem mill can be tracked accurately, and the faults, of the data error of the set value of the band steel, rolling band breakage, the error of the shearing position, etc., caused by tracking errors of the band steel are effectively avoided. The downtime of a machine set is reduced, and the operation rate of the machine set and the economic benefit of an enterprise are improved.

technical field [0001] The invention belongs to the field of steel rolling automatic control, in particular to a tracking processing method for strip steel in a cold continuous rolling mill. Background technique [0002] The purpose of strip tracking is to enable the computer to know the exact position of the material on the production line and its control status at any time, so that the computer can start the relevant functional programs within the specified time, and perform various controls on the designated rolled piece, including setting value data requests , wedge rolling, shear position calculation, etc., so as to ensure the continuous and automatic operation of the production process. Strip tracking control is a key technology in the production process of tandem cold rolling mill, and it is the premise guarantee for realizing continuous rolling control.
